Welcome to Arcola ...

Arcola is located in Hale County<1>.



While we don't have a date for the founding of Arcola, you might get a feel for it by knowing that during our research the earliest mention that we found (so far) was in a book dated 1895.

Arcola is 120 feet [37 m] above sea level.<2>.

Time Zone: Arcola lies in the Central Time Zone (CST/CDT) and observes daylight saving time

Using our Gazetteer, we found that there are 21 communities that are also named Arcola - they are located in Georgia, Illinois, Indiana, Kansas (5), Louisiana, Maryland, Minnesota, Mississippi, Missouri, New Jersey, North Carolina, Pennsylvania, Saskatchewan, Texas, Virginia, West Virginia and Wyoming.
